M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
changes in
electronic educational technology are providing the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to take courses via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
issues that
e-learning technology institutions
are having to attend to
today because online learning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can institutions
guarantee that
the education provided by these
MOOC courses is
acceptable?
How can institutions
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ach online?
What different business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Yale University to conduct these MOOC courses?
What assessment str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can stakeholders
handle problems like
poor
motivation and high
student attrition?
